Are there any mobile browsers that offer built-in cryptocurrency wallets?
Can you recommend any mobile browsers that have built-in cryptocurrency wallets? I'm looking for a convenient way to access my cryptocurrencies on the go without having to install separate wallet apps. Are there any options available?
3 answers
- AKSHAJ BISHTAug 13, 2025 · 8 months agoYes, there are several mobile browsers that offer built-in cryptocurrency wallets. One popular option is the Opera browser, which has a built-in crypto wallet that allows you to store and manage your cryptocurrencies directly within the browser. It sup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ies and provides a user-friendly interface for easy access. Another option is the Brave browser, which also has a built-in wallet that supports various cryptocurrencies. It focuses on privacy and security, and offers features like ad-blocking and tracker protection. Both of these browsers are available for both Android and iOS devices.
